Press release:

NOBODY BUT YOU is the first music video from the British female fronted Melodic Hard Rock Band TAO. The song comes from their debut album ‘PROPHECY’.

TAO, which features Karen Fell (vocals), Chris Gould (guitars) and Dave Rosingana (bass), will release their album “Prophecy” on the 15th of October 2021 via Tarot Label Media.

 

Track listing:

1. Nobody But You

2. Rock Brigade

3. Angels And Clandestine Fools

4. Breathe In, Breathe Out

5. Fire In The Sky

6. Might Just Break your Heart

7. Prophecy 8. Fight Club

9. Nazarene

10. Gone Forever

 

The album was produced by Gary Hughes (TEN) and mixed and mastered by Dennis Ward at The TrakShak, Germany. All songs written by Gary Hughes Recorded at The Doghouse Studio, Blackpool, England

Line-up:

Karen Fell – Vocals

Chris Gould– Guitars (ex-Serpentine)

Dave Rosingana – Bass Guitars

Additional Musicians:

Darrel Treece-Birch (TEN) - Keyboards

Brian Webster - Drums

Gary Hughes (TEN) - Backing Vocals and keyboards on "Prophecy" and "Nazarene".

Hailing from Edinburgh (Scotland), Cardiff (Wales) and Barrow in England, the female fronted melodic hard rock band TAO is the living proof of the legacy of the melodic hard rock genre in the UK. Bringing together a strong team of individual musicians under the watchful eye and songwriting prowess of TEN mastermind Gary Hughes, this band is poised for great things, with this brilliant collection of songs, under the album title “Prophecy”.

With Karen Fell’s passionate vocals, Chris Gould’s emotional yet furious guitar playing (where it needs to be) and Dave Rosingana’s unmistakable bass tones, this release will definitely hit a soft spot of fans of 80s influenced melodic hard rock in the vein of Heart, Roxette or Pat Benatar.
